| void GetBrightnessM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| // Spec implementation |
| // (http://dvcs.w3.org/hg/FXTF/raw-file/tip/filters/index.html#brightnessEquivalent) |
| // <feFunc[R|G|B] type="linear" slope="[amount]"> |
| memset(matrix, 0, 20 * sizeof(SkScalar)); |
| matrix[0] = matrix[6] = matrix[12] = amount; |
| mat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| } |
| |
| void GetSaturatingBrightnessM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| // Legacy implementation used by internal clients. |
| // <feFunc[R|G|B] type="linear" intercept="[amount]"/> |
| memset(matrix, 0, 20 * sizeof(SkScalar)); |
| matrix[0] = matrix[6] = matrix[12] = mat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| matrix[4] = matrix[9] = matrix[14] = amount * 255.f; |
| } |
| |
| void GetContrastM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| memset(matrix, 0, 20 * sizeof(SkScalar)); |
| matrix[0] = matrix[6] = matrix[12] = amount; |
| matrix[4] = matrix[9] = matrix[14] = (-0.5f * amount + 0.5f) * 255.f; |
| mat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| } |
| |
| void GetSaturateM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| // Note, these values are computed to ensure MatrixNeedsClamping is false |
| // for amount in [0..1] |
| matrix[0] = 0.213f + 0.787f * amount; |
| matrix[1] = 0.715f - 0.715f * amount; |
| matrix[2] = 1.f - (matrix[0] + matrix[1]); |
| matrix[3] = matrix[4] = 0.f; |
| matrix[5] = 0.213f - 0.213f * amount; |
| matrix[6] = 0.715f + 0.285f * amount; |
| matrix[7] = 1.f - (matrix[5] + matrix[6]); |
| matrix[8] = matrix[9] = 0.f; |
| matrix[10] = 0.213f - 0.213f * amount; |
| matrix[11] = 0.715f - 0.715f * amount; |
| matrix[12] = 1.f - (matrix[10] + matrix[11]); |
| matrix[13] = matrix[14] = 0.f; |
| matrix[15] = matrix[16] = matrix[17] = matrix[19] = 0.f; |
| mat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| } |
| |
| void GetHueRotateMatrix(float hue,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| const float kPi = 3.1415926535897932384626433832795f; |
| |
| float cos_hue = cosf(hue * kPi / 180.f); |
| float sin_hue = sinf(hue * kPi / 180.f); |
| matrix[0] = 0.213f + cos_hue * 0.787f - sin_hue * 0.213f; |
| matrix[1] = 0.715f - cos_hue * 0.715f - sin_hue * 0.715f; |
| matrix[2] = 0.072f - cos_hue * 0.072f + sin_hue * 0.928f; |
| matrix[3] = matrix[4] = 0.f; |
| matrix[5] = 0.213f - cos_hue * 0.213f + sin_hue * 0.143f; |
| matrix[6] = 0.715f + cos_hue * 0.285f + sin_hue * 0.140f; |
| matrix[7] = 0.072f - cos_hue * 0.072f - sin_hue * 0.283f; |
| matrix[8] = matrix[9] = 0.f; |
| matrix[10] = 0.213f - cos_hue * 0.213f - sin_hue * 0.787f; |
| matrix[11] = 0.715f - cos_hue * 0.715f + sin_hue * 0.715f; |
| matrix[12] = 0.072f + cos_hue * 0.928f + sin_hue * 0.072f; |
| matrix[13] = matrix[14] = 0.f; |
| matrix[15] = matrix[16] = matrix[17] = 0.f; |
| mat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| matrix[19] = 0.f; |
| } |
| |
| void GetInvertM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| memset(matrix, 0, 20 * sizeof(SkScalar)); |
| matrix[0] = matrix[6] = matrix[12] = 1.f - 2.f * amount; |
| matrix[4] = matrix[9] = matrix[14] = amount * 255.f; |
| mat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| } |
| |
| void GetOpacityM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| memset(matrix, 0, 20 * sizeof(SkScalar)); |
| matrix[0] = matrix[6] = matrix[12] = 1.f; |
| matrix[18] = amount; |
| } |
| |
| void GetGrayscaleM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| // Note, these values are computed to ensure MatrixNeedsClamping is false |
| // for amount in [0..1] |
| matrix[0] = 0.2126f + 0.7874f * amount; |
| matrix[1] = 0.7152f - 0.7152f * amount; |
| matrix[2] = 1.f - (matrix[0] + matrix[1]); |
| matrix[3] = matrix[4] = 0.f; |
| |
| matrix[5] = 0.2126f - 0.2126f * amount; |
| matrix[6] = 0.7152f + 0.2848f * amount; |
| matrix[7] = 1.f - (matrix[5] + matrix[6]); |
| matrix[8] = matrix[9] = 0.f; |
| |
| matrix[10] = 0.2126f - 0.2126f * amount; |
| matrix[11] = 0.7152f - 0.7152f * amount; |
| matrix[12] = 1.f - (matrix[10] + matrix[11]); |
| matrix[13] = matrix[14] = 0.f; |
| |
| matrix[15] = matrix[16] = matrix[17] = matrix[19] = 0.f; |
| mat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| } |
| |
| void GetSepiaMatrix(float amount, S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| matrix[0] = 0.393f + 0.607f * amount; |
| matrix[1] = 0.769f - 0.769f * amount; |
| matrix[2] = 0.189f - 0.189f * amount; |
| matrix[3] = matrix[4] = 0.f; |
| |
| matrix[5] = 0.349f - 0.349f * amount; |
| matrix[6] = 0.686f + 0.314f * amount; |
| matrix[7] = 0.168f - 0.168f * amount; |
| matrix[8] = matrix[9] = 0.f; |
| |
| matrix[10] = 0.272f - 0.272f * amount; |
| matrix[11] = 0.534f - 0.534f * amount; |
| matrix[12] = 0.131f + 0.869f * amount; |
| matrix[13] = matrix[14] = 0.f; |
| |
| matrix[15] = matrix[16] = matrix[17] = matrix[19] = 0.f; |
| matrix[18] = 1.f; |
| } |

| // The 5x4 matrix is really a "compressed" version of a 5x5 matrix that'd have |
| // (0 0 0 0 1) as a last row, and that would be applied to a 5-vector extended |
| // from the 4-vector color with a 1. |
| void MultColorMatrix(SkScalar a[20], SkScalar b[20], SkScalar out[20]) { |
| for (int j = 0; j < 4; ++j) { |
| for (int i = 0; i < 5; ++i) { |
| out[i+j*5] = i == 4 ? a[4+j*5] : 0.f; |
| for (int k = 0; k < 4; ++k) |
| out[i+j*5] += a[k+j*5] * b[i+k*5]; |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| |
| // To detect if we need to apply clamping after applying a matrix, we check if |
| // any output component might go outside of [0, 255] for any combination of |
| // input components in [0..255]. |
| // Each output component is an affine transformation of the input component, so |
| // the minimum and maximum values are for any combination of minimum or maximum |
| // values of input components (i.e. 0 or 255). |
| // E.g. if R' = x*R + y*G + z*B + w*A + t |
| // Then the maximum value will be for R=255 if x>0 or R=0 if x<0, and the |
| // minimum value will be for R=0 if x>0 or R=255 if x<0. |
| // Same goes for all components. |
| bool ComponentNeedsClamping(SkScalar row[5]) { |
| SkScalar max_value = row[4] / 255.f; |
| SkScalar min_value = row[4] / 255.f; |
| for (int i = 0; i < 4; ++i) { |
| if (row[i] > 0) |
| max_value += row[i]; |
| else |
| min_value += row[i]; |
| } |
| return (max_value > 1.f) || (min_value < 0.f); |
| } |
| |
| bool MatrixNeedsClamping(SkScalar matrix[20]) { |
| return ComponentNeedsClamping(matrix) |
| || ComponentNeedsClamping(matrix+5) |
| || ComponentNeedsClamping(matrix+10) |
| || ComponentNeedsClamping(matrix+15); |
| } |
